49ers Draft Dashon Goldson at 126

With their second pick in the 4th-round, the 49ers select Dashon Goldson, DB, Washington.

OVERVIEW
Moved from safety to corner during 2006 spring; made an interception at his new position in the 2006 Spring Game. … Prep teammate of UW corner Roy Lewis. … Earned his bachelor’s degree in American Ethnic Studies in June 2006.


ANALYSIS
Positives: Good size for the position. … Legitimate athlete who stood out as a free safety in 2004-05 and was expected to be moved to cornerback as a senior. … An offseason ankle injury and injuries to other defensive backs limited his time at cornerback to only a handful of games. … Practiced exclusively at cornerback at the East-West Shrine Game and helped his cause. Best in man coverage, where he can allow his size and pure athleticism to take over. Good read and reaction skills. Reliable open-field tackler. Quick to support the run.

Negatives: Might lack the pure speed to remain at cornerback, thus our ranking him at free safety. … Lacks the elite catch-up acceleration. … Effective open-field tackler, but not a punisher. … Reliable in coverage, but isn’t considered a playmaker. … Intercepted four passes and forced one fumble in 32 career games. Should be able to shed blockers better after spending most of his career at safety, but looks to beat them with merely his athleticism rather than technique.
